Output 35031b3b752d3c59a6c79249acfcd12c0234472d672aa7d0fa894194b1fbcfaf:16

value
70586
script pubkey
OP_0 OP_PUSHBYTES_20 3e297ba0d9395343ed1aee0a64b00f1497396685
address
bc1q8c5hhgxe89f58mg6ac9xfvq0zjtnje59pl8p5l
transaction
35031b3b752d3c59a6c79249acfcd12c0234472d672aa7d0fa894194b1fbcfaf
spent
true